<h1 class="pgc-h-arrow-right" > hen cry, unlucky</h1>

It is normal for hens to lay eggs and roosters to crow, but some hens imitate roosters and crow, which is obviously a little abnormal. Some superstitious people believe that the hen learning to rooster bark is an ominous omen, and there will be bad things happening.

The main reason why people think this way is that in the very early days, people could not give a scientific explanation for this relatively rare strange phenomenon, and coupled with the influence of feudal superstition, they often associated this strange phenomenon with gods and ghosts, and regarded it as gods and ghosts at work.

Some people have a chicken learning rooster chirping at home, and it just so happens that some unfortunate things happen, such as fires, dead people, etc., they will hard link these two things, add oil and sauce, the more true they say, the more widely spread, the result is that "the hen cries unlucky" saying.

In fact, the hen sings because its normal secretion in the body has encountered obstacles, and the result of the decrease in female hormones and the increase in male hormones is not worth the fuss, nor is it a harbinger. People are so afraid that they are influenced by their superstitious ideas and put a disguise on this phenomenon.

<h1 class="pgc-h-arrow-right" > rooster is a bad omen</h1>

People in the past were very superstitious, thinking that roosters should bark in the morning, and other times they would bark. It is said that the rooster is spiritual and can see some unclean things that humans can't see. "Rooster trouble" is caused by seeing something unclean, which is an unlucky performance and a bad omen.

Therefore, whenever the situation of "rooster trouble" is encountered, people will directly kill the rooster to break the ominous omen, thinking that the rooster is also a thing to avoid evil, killing the rooster can avoid disasters, and bad things will not find their own home.

Back in the past, because of the occurrence of wars in ancient times, in the middle of the night, the rooster will be disturbed by sound and fire and cry loudly at night, so the ancients took "rooster night chirping" as a fierce omen of war, so the rooster crowing in the middle of the night will be considered an unlucky phenomenon by the old man.

In real life, the phenomenon of roosters not chirping normally and making noise will also affect their own and neighbors' living habits. Often the neighbors will be upset after a long time, which can easily cause disharmony in the neighborhood. Even the "rooster disturbance" involved in small things will cause the contradiction to intensify, so the rooster disturbance is also regarded as a harbinger of neighbor disputes.

In fact, the rooster is also a habit of the rooster, according to the relevant expert research, the rooster has a pineal gland in the brain, will secrete melatonin at night, if there is a sudden light, the secretion of melatonin will be inhibited, the rooster will be released by singing. In addition, the rooster chirping is also a declaration of sovereignty, which means to indicate its position in the family, but also to declare territory to other chickens and not let other chickens infringe on it.
